Aims and Scope of International Journal of Nephrology and Renovascular Disease
The International Journal of Nephrology and Renovascular Disease is an open-access peer-reviewed medical journal focusing on kidney and vascular supply studies. It was established in 2008 and is published by Dove Medical Press. It is abstracted and indexed in PubMed, EMBASE, and Scopus. Less
